Lucas and Luna sit on a sunlit cabin porch overlooking a quiet lake, talking about what it really takes to quit your job and live off investments. No pipe dreams, no get-rich-quick schemes — just the math: safe withdrawal rates, dividend yields, tax strategies, sequence-of-return risk, and the behavioral discipline of not selling when markets tumble. Each episode examines a real portfolio, a case study of someone who actually did it (or tried to), or a specific financial product like annuities, REITs, or bond ladders.
